Contract: 24 months
You will be working on structured short-term placements throughout all areas of our Recycling & Recovery business over a 24-month scheme.
We will develop your understanding of the waste management industry and teach you all aspects of general management.
There is travel expected in this role and some nights away from home. You are provided with a fully expensed company car, and we will provide and pay for your accommodation.
When you join SUEZ, you get more than a brand-new role. Your work will help us deliver innovative and environmentally responsible solutions for water and waste management. You will get a chance to help us preserve and restore our planet's natural capital for future generations.
Developing a comprehensive understanding of how SUEZ operates and competes within the waste management sector through specific work packages across the Processing business by supporting various projects and initiatives to give full exposure of the business.
From time to time, you will be given personal projects to work on within specific areas of the Processing business.
Undertaking professional and personal development by improving your own knowledge of the waste management industry.
- A full UK driving licence is required and be confident to drive long distances.
- Must currently live or be willing to relocate to the relevant region for the duration of the scheme.
- Must be OK with being away from home as overnight stays will be required.
- Preferably you will already have some work experience to underpin your academic record.
